Hi, Is there any documentation about a standard filesystem layout? For user data storage like music, videos etc. On Mac OS X there are pre-define folders for Movies, Music, Pictures and Applications. It would save a lot of time searching with file dialogs if a standard was proposed for applications. Example, an application which plays mp3s would look in Music by default.
Well, there's FHS (file system hierarchy standard). But it more about the system than the user's music... I don't see the interest of a "My Picture" or a "My Music" folder. In fact, I tend to hate that way of doing things. And I think a lot of users will want to organise things the way they want...
